Unpublished Manuscripts By Dr. Seuss Discovered, Three New Books Coming Soon
February 18, 2015
Random House publishing company announced that three new books from the late Dr. Seuss will be published after original manuscripts and sketches were discovered in the beloved author's home.

"What Pet Should I Get?" will be published on July 28 - nearly 24 years after Theodor Seuss Geisel's death.

A box filled with pages of text and sketches was found shortly after Geisel's death when his widow, Audrey Geisel, was remodeling her home. The box was set aside and rediscovered in 2013.

"What Pet Should I Get?" will be Dr. Seuss' 46th book. The titles and publication dates for the other new books will be announced later, Random House said.
